U2   04/04/1987

Activity Center. Arizona State U, Tempe, AZ
Source Aiwa CM-30 > Sony WM-D3 > analog cass (M) transferred Nakamichi CR-7A > TC FInalizer (JEMs remaster > Marantz CDR-160 > cdr > flac
Media cdr   2 discs
Tech Notes As noted, the second night of the tour and Bono's voice is failing him, but instead of holding back the malady propels him and the band to an inspired performance. Hard to believe such a "rig" could yield this recording but it did; the remaster was mostly for levels and a touch of sharpening. The show sounds gloriously wide open, translucent and every bit as good as what's being done on this year's tour if not better. Don't let the bit of crowd at the start fool you.

There was a crowd surge to the stage during "People Get Ready" that accidentally shut off the deck, but Brother KM did get most of the song and restarted in time to catch the ending.

The transfer/remaster was done by me a few years ago and some U2 collectors may have this version indirectly (the circulating version appears to be called Back in the Desert), but I see many many inferior versions on lists out there (from the bootlegs Joshua Tree in Flames and Governor Mecham & MLK). This is the real thing from the master cassette and the original remastered CD-R made from it.
